coDiagnostiX®, CARES® Visual and CARES® Model Builder play together seamlessly. coDiagnostiX® implant planning data can be transferred to CARES® Visual. Both applications provide complete data visualization in order to achieve real-time surgical and restorative case planning.

For 3D printed guided surgery cases, CARES® Model Builder integrates into the Synergy workflow to enable precise positioning of the implant locators on the digital impression. It also creates a 3D printed gingival area and a hole for the analog to be easily snapped into a CARES® 3D printed model.

The “measure twice, cut once” philosophy has never been more true than in the dental industry. The clinical outcome of freehand surgery is often unpredictable. Even when an implant is well placed, the location may not be precise enough to meet optimal prosthodontic requirements. When clinicians want to minimize their risk of errors, they turn to guided surgery.

Preplan the most accurate placement for implants

Get the right prosthetic support

Improve the esthetic emergence profile of the restoration

More easily load immediate provisional restorations6

Reduce surgical time

WHY?An improperly positioned implant can lead to peri-implant disease, soft tissue loss, bone loss, can compromise the esthetic restoration, and can prove difficult to restore.2,3 Greater accuracy can be achieved with the help of implant planning software and 3D printed surgical guides, allowing the clinician to:4,5

HOW?With Straumann® CARES® 3D printing technology, a dental lab or clinician can print two dental implant models and two precision designed surgical guides in about an hour of production time. For a fully digital workflow, you simply scan the patient’s mouth, design and print a guide to indicate where the implants should be placed, mill a provisional, then verify the implant, abutment and crown fit before beginning surgery.

WHY?With a fully-digital guided surgery workflow, necessary teeth are extracted, dental implants are placed and a temporary restoration (also known as a provisional) are provided to the patient in a single appointment. After the healing phase is complete, the patient returns to have the final restoration placed and can begin life with their new smile. This immediacy solution offers greater precision for the restoration, and the convenience of fewer visits for the patient.
